匠心精神 - 良心品质腾讯认可的专业机构-IT人的高薪实战学院

咨询电话:4000806560

极简阿里云Go Web框架Serverless版,教你用Serverless实现高性能Web应用

极简阿里云Go Web框架Serverless版,教你用Serverless实现高性能Web应用

随着云计算技术的发展,越来越多的企业开始使用Serverless架构来构建高性能、可靠、灵活的Web应用程序。Serverless是一种全新的云计算服务,可以帮助应用程序实现自动化、高效率的部署和运行。本文介绍了如何使用极简阿里云Go Web框架Serverless版来构建高性能的Web应用程序。

1. Serverless架构简介

Serverless架构是一种基于云计算平台的架构模式,它消除了传统应用程序中必须安装、配置、维护操作系统和应用服务器等基础设施的需求。Serverless架构使用云服务提供商的基础设施来运行应用程序,构建了一个全新的架构模式,它可以提供更高的可靠性和灵活性。

Serverless架构基于事件触发,应用程序只有在需要执行时才会被激活,而不需要一直运行。这样的优势是节省了资源,降低了成本,同时也提高了性能和可靠性。

2. 阿里云函数计算架构简介

阿里云函数计算是一种Serverless计算服务,它可以帮助开发者更高效地构建和运行事件驱动型的应用程序。函数计算提供了全托管的计算资源,简化了应用开发和部署的过程,支持事件驱动型应用程序的开发。

阿里云函数计算是无服务器的,只有在有事件发生时才会运行代码,使用阿里云函数计算,开发者可以轻松构建高性能、可扩展的应用程序,维护和管理成本也大大降低。

3. 极简阿里云Go Web框架Serverless版

极简阿里云Go Web框架Serverless版是一种基于阿里云函数计算服务的Web框架,它可以帮助开发者更快地构建高性能、可靠的Web应用程序。极简阿里云Go Web框架Serverless版支持RESTful API,使用简单,开发快速。

使用极简阿里云Go Web框架Serverless版,开发者不需要关心服务器、网络等基础设施,只需要专注于业务逻辑的开发。同时,极简阿里云Go Web框架Serverless版还提供丰富的插件机制和多种部署方案,帮助开发者更高效地完成Web应用程序的开发和部署。

4. 如何使用极简阿里云Go Web框架Serverless版

使用极简阿里云Go Web框架Serverless版,首先需要安装阿里云函数计算和golang。然后,按照以下步骤进行配置和部署:

- 创建一个新的函数计算服务
- 创建一个新的阿里云Web框架,使用极简阿里云Go Web框架Serverless版作为基础框架
- 配置服务参数,例如函数名称、运行环境、函数入口等
- 使用阿里云函数计算控制台,上传并部署代码

5. 极简阿里云Go Web框架Serverless版的优势

极简阿里云Go Web框架Serverless版的优势在于:

- 无需关注服务器和网络等基础设施,只需专注于业务逻辑的开发
- 支持RESTful API,使用简单,开发快速
- 提供丰富的插件机制和多种部署方案,帮助开发者更高效地完成Web应用程序的开发和部署
- 高性能、可靠、安全,满足企业级Web应用程序的需求

6. 总结

Serverless架构是一种全新的云计算模式,它可以帮助开发者更高效地构建和运行应用程序。极简阿里云Go Web框架Serverless版是一种基于阿里云函数计算服务的Web框架,它可以帮助开发者更快地构建高性能、可靠的Web应用程序。在使用极简阿里云Go Web框架Serverless版时,开发者只需专注于业务逻辑的开发,无需关注服务器和网络等基础设施,从而节省时间和成本,提高开发效率。